Kenyon College vs Illinois Wesleyan University (IWU)
Kenyon College and Illinois Wesleyan University, both esteemed liberal arts institutions, offer distinct educational experiences. Kenyon, nestled in Gambier, Ohio, boasts a lower acceptance rate (29%) compared to Illinois Wesleyan's (58%) in Bloomington, Illinois. Kenyon's student body is slightly smaller, fostering a close-knit community, while Illinois Wesleyan's larger student population provides a more diverse and vibrant campus life. While both institutions excel in the humanities and social sciences, Kenyon is known for its strengths in English, history, and foreign languages, while Illinois Wesleyan shines in psychology, biology, and business.
